Low Power FM Movement Wins Victory on Capitol Hill

HeadlineOct 16, 2009

Supporters of expanding low power FM radio stations won a victory Thursday when the House Energy and Commerce Committee passed the Local Community Radio Act. The bill aims to repeal restrictions that drastically limit channels available to low power FM stations.
